Useful in following cases:
Preset out of the box on DU for customers who need to enable SRIOV or PCI Device Passthrough.
Speed up the device enabling process
Reduce human errors by avoiding manual invention to Scheduler filters
Removes need to restart scheduler service for this purpose
No Post Playbook is required to add the filter
Eliminates functionality loss due to DU upgrade during timeframe between enabling the filter on DU and making the postplaybook available for DU upgrade to process.
Reference:
https://docs.openstack.org/neutron/rocky/admin/config-sriov.html#configure-nova-scheduler-controller